Transaction 5e6f367061c98b590f224c5398621782e390c000206ffd4ec62fab4292f68937

1 Input
2 Outputs
  • 5e6f367061c98b590f224c5398621782e390c000206ffd4ec62fab4292f68937:0
  • value  1576817
    address  38LDHJ3LeWEo2Q3dMRzvMrke5jSacspBgY
  • 5e6f367061c98b590f224c5398621782e390c000206ffd4ec62fab4292f68937:1
  • value  28561794
    address  bc1qdd8dmdr8v7p3k9slc70g0ty7mjlv64gfc4jweu